Deep Worldbuilding on Prime Video

Expanding the Na’vi Lore

Avatar: Fire and Ash enriches Pandora’s mythologies by introducing new clans and ecosystems. Each tribe carries distinct visual design and cultural traits that broaden the universe beyond the original film.

This deeper worldbuilding rewards attentive viewers and invites analysis of how environment shapes society, a core strength of the franchise.

Visual and Technical Breakthroughs

Cinematic Techniques on Streaming

Though created for theatrical release, the film utilizes cutting edge capture methods that translate powerfully to Prime Video. Wide shots showcase scale, while intimate framing maintains emotional clarity even in crowded scenes.

High frame rate usage accentuates smooth motion in action set pieces, reinforcing the sensation of being present on Pandora during key confrontations.

Character Driven Narrative Focus

Family as the Core Theme

The story centers on the bond between Jake, Neytiri, and their children, framing survival as a collective responsibility rather than an individual quest. This shift grounds the larger conflict in relatable parental instincts and generational legacy.

Supporting characters from the first film return with meaningful roles, ensuring continuity while advancing the central journey with renewed urgency.

Action, Strategy, and Environmental Messaging

Tactile Combat and Ecological Themes

Choreographed battles emphasize physical stakes and tactical coordination, making use of diverse biomes as both stage and weapon. The forest, ocean, and volcanic regions each contribute to set piece variety and narrative tension.

Underneath the spectacle, the film underscores the cost of resource extraction and displacement, aligning environmental stakes with character motivation in a way that feels integral rather than didactic.
